Perks of Advanced Cataract Surgical Procedure



When considering innovative cataract surgical treatment, you can expect better vision and faster recuperation times compared to conventional approaches. Advanced cataract surgical treatment methods, such as laser-assisted treatments, use better accuracy in removing the gloomy lens and replacing it with a clear artificial lens. This accuracy brings about far better visual end results, with numerous individuals experiencing significantly sharper vision post-surgery. Additionally, progressed cataract surgical procedure often leads to faster recuperation times, enabling you to resume your day-to-day activities more quickly.

Another benefit of sophisticated cataract surgical treatment is minimized reliance on glasses or call lenses after the procedure. With developments in intraocular lens innovation, surgeons can currently offer lens implants that remedy not just cataracts however additionally other refractive errors like n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ism. This suggests that you might accomplish more clear vision at various ranges without the requirement for restorative eyeglasses.

Risks and Complications to Take into consideration



Considering advanced cataract surgery also involves recognizing the prospective dangers and difficulties that might develop throughout or after the treatment.



While sophisticated cataract surgery is usually secure, like any kind of surgery, there are some risks to be aware of. These may include infection, bleeding, inflammation, or swelling. Sometimes, there may be problems with the intraocular lens, such as misplacement or clouding of the lens. Additionally, there's a small risk of retinal detachment or glaucoma establishing after the surgical treatment.

Complications can additionally arise throughout the recuperation procedure. Some individuals may experience enhanced eye pressure, resulting in discomfort or adjustments in vision. It's critical to comply with post-operative care directions carefully to decrease these dangers. If you observe any sudden changes in your vision, serious discomfort, or various other worrying signs and symptoms, call your eye cosmetic surgeon promptly.

While these dangers exist, it's necessary to consider them versus the prospective benefits of enhanced vision and lifestyle that progressed cataract surgical procedure can offer.

Person Viability and Qualification



To determine if you're suitable for advanced cataract surgical procedure, your eye specialist will assess various factors including the health and wellness of your eyes and general medical history. Elements such as the intensity of your cataracts, the visibility of various other eye conditions like glaucoma or macular degeneration, and the general wellness of your eyes will certainly all be taken into account. Furthermore, your specialist will evaluate your general health and wellness status, consisting of any type of clinical conditions you may have and medicines you're taking.
